Paul Visk Belleville Il. 618-406-4705 Watch ""Fly Now" ?The trailer https://youtu.be/A_ZqJYNU54s <div>-------- Original message --------</div><div>From: Sid Wood via KRnet <krnet at list.krnet.org> </div><div>Date:06/08/2015 9:38 PM (GMT-06:00) </div><div>To: krnet at list.krnet.org </div><div>Cc: Sid Wood <smwood at md.metrocast.net> </div><div>Subject: KR> Young Eagles Rally </div><div> </div>What to do when your EAA Chapter 478 has a Young Eagles Rally, your KR-2 is still serving a Phase 1, 40-hour sentence, and the local FBO, that you normally rent a C-150, just went out of business? Take off the upper cowl and do a pre-flight show & tell briefing for the 155 kids signed up to fly that morning at the Rally. I did 4 to 8 kids at a time so that the pilots did not need to take the ten minutes or so to do the brief for each flight. That really helped speed up air operations. Plus the kids were able to actually see an aircraft engine. I only did the briefing 27 times. We managed to fly 132 Young Eagles using 14 aircraft before thunder storms shut us down.
